For job seekers in Shock, partnering with a well-marketed agency offers distinct advantages. These agencies have invested in building relationships with employers you may not find on mainstream job boards. They understand the specific skills in demand, from technical trades to healthcare support, which are crucial in our local economy. By marketing themselves effectively to companies, they gain exclusive access to openings. Your resume lands directly on a hiring manager’s desk, bypassing the automated filters that often sideline qualified applicants. It’s a personalized approach in an increasingly impersonal digital job market.
The actionable value for Shock lies in engagement. If you're a business owner struggling to find reliable skilled labor, seek out a recruitment agency that actively markets its candidate network. Ask them how they promote roles and what channels they use to reach passive talent in the region. For job seekers, your task is to be findable. Ensure your LinkedIn profile and professional online presence highlight skills relevant to local industries. Engage with agencies that have a strong, visible brand in West Virginia; their marketing reach becomes your network.
